Sean Murray's fondness for the 2016 version of No Man's Sky reveals a unique charm that many players may overlook. While the game has evolved significantly, the original experience is filled with quirky surprises and a sense of wonder that feels nostalgic. "It’s a little bit weirder, but it’s got its charm." The simplicity of exploration in the earlier version provides a refreshing contrast to the complexities added later. - Players often reminisce about the unexpected encounters and the vivid landscapes. - The original mechanics, albeit limited, fostered a unique sense of freedom. It’s worth revisiting for those who appreciate the heart of the game before the extensive updates. For new players, experiencing the game as it was initially released offers a different perspective on its evolution.
